This part of the test is filled with multiple choice questions for you to answer that all have to do with the information you learned during your course and study.
The first half is generally made up of about 100 different questions. This part of the test takes most people somewhere between 1 and 2 hours to complete. There’s no bonus to completing it early though, as you need to sit down in the test-taking room until everyone who is taking it with you has completed their tests. Once you complete the first half, and once everyone else is done, you’ll be able to move on to the second half of the examination- the skills test. cna training
